Ticket: vendored font sync fails silently on the Corvid design system. Repro: run the font sync script on a clean checkout, note that the Quillsans family downloads zero files but exits with code 0. Expected: nonzero exit and a clear error. Suspect the mirror's auth check changed. For the sync to reach the mirror at all, it needs the access token below.

portal login ticket: eyJhbGciOiJIUzI1NiIsInR5cCI6IkpXVCJ9.eyJzdWIiOiIwEOsktwVNwIn0.-UJU3fdyyCgG

Test Plan Note — Calendar Sync Conflict (Tindervale Scheduler)

Scenario: two clients edit the same event offline, then sync. Expected behavior: the Larkmoor merge service keeps the later timestamp and files a conflict record. Verify the losing edit appears in the conflicts pane and no duplicate events are created. Run against the staging tenant only. Authenticate your test client to the sync endpoint using the bearer token below.

bearer token for hagug-kawip: eyJhbGciOiJIUzI1NiIsInR5cCI6IkpXVCJ9.eyJzdWIiOiIydxNAjDeTmIn0.L86yxoGFcrhy

Welcome to the Bramblecut team. Our main tool is `thumbler`, a CLI that batch-resizes images for the Ostmere catalog pipeline. You pass it a manifest file, a target profile, and an output bucket; it handles fan-out, retries, and checksum verification automatically. Most jobs finish in minutes. Install instructions, profile definitions, and common flag combinations are documented on the internal page below.

runbook for tafof-yawif: https://confluence.tolvaqsys.internal/display/display/browse/pages/7be3

## Idempotency Keys for Payment Retries (Lumopay)

Every retry of a charge request must reuse the original idempotency key; generating a new key on retry can produce duplicate charges. Keys are scoped per merchant and expire after 48 hours. Reviewers should verify keys are derived server-side, never from client input. The full key-generation specification and threat model are maintained on the internal page.

dashboard of kaguf-tawip = https://vault.merlaqsys.test/issue